You can configure existing instances of identity provider (IdP) adapters.

Depending on the selected adapter, the IdP Adapters window presents different configuration parameters.

  1. Go to Authentication > Integration > IdP Adapters.
  2. Click the IdP adapter instance you want to configure.
  3. Follow the in-product instructions to configure the adapter instance.
    Note:

    If this is a child instance, select the Override check box to modify the configuration.

    If you are configuring one of the bundled adapters, see Bundled adapters or Integrate with PingID for PingFederate SSO for configuration information.

    If you are configuring an adapter from an integration kit, including any software as a service (SaaS) connector, go to Integration overview, locate the adapter's documentation, and configure the adapter instance accordingly.
